Abstract

A supply element for a laboratory microchip includes a sealed substance source. A seal in the substance source is opened in response to the supply element and the microchip being joined together. While the seal is open, the substance is transferred from the substance source to a supplier in the microchip. The substance is moved from the supplier in the microchip to the microfluid structure by applying a potential to the microchip. The supply element is releasably attached to the supply equipment by releasably attaching the supply element with a bayonet lock.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A supply element for a laboratory microchip with a microfluid structure for at least one of chemical, physical, or biological processing, the microchip having a first supplier to supply substances to the microchip and a second supplier to supply a potential to the microchip to move substances corresponding to the microfluid structure, the supply element comprising: 
 at least one substance-containing third supplier adapted to contain a substance, said at least one third supplier having a seal arranged to be opened to the microchip in response to the supply element and the microchip being joined together to enable said substance to be transferred from said at least one third supplier to the first supplier of the microchip.    
     
     
         2 . The supply element of  claim 1 , wherein said seal comprises a chemically resistant substance.  
     
     
         3 . The supply element of  claim 1 , wherein said seal comprises a wax.  
     
     
         4 . The supply element of  claim 1 , wherein said at least one third supplier comprises at least one end sealed by a membrane that is flush with a side surface of the supply element.  
     
     
         5 . The supply element of  claim 4 , wherein said membrane comprises a chemically resistant material.  
     
     
         6 . The supply element of  claim 4 , wherein said membrane comprises one of a metal or a gas-permeable polymer.  
     
     
         7 . The supply element of  claim 1 , wherein said substance of said third supplier comprises at least one substance sample.  
     
     
         8 . The supply element of  claim 1 , wherein said substance of said third supplier comprises at least one substance reagent.  
     
     
         9 . The supply element of  claim 1 , wherein said substance of said third supplier comprises at least one substance sample and at least one substance reagent.  
     
     
         10 . The supply element of  claim 1 , further comprising a fourth supplier to transfer the potential to the microchip, said fourth supplier being arranged to be coupled to the corresponding second supplier on the microchip.  
     
     
         11 . The supply element of  claim 1 , further comprising an attachment arrangement to releasably attach the supply element to supply equipment.  
     
     
         12 . The supply element of  claim 11 , wherein said attachment arrangement comprises a bayonet lock.  
     
     
         13 . The supply element of  claim 1 , further comprising a first coding arrangement to identify the supply element to a second corresponding coding arrangement of supply equipment.  
     
     
         14 . The supply element of  claim 1 , further comprising first and second assemblies, said first assembly being adapted to contain a module carrying said supply element and supply equipment and said module being adapted to be releasably connected to said second assembly.  
     
     
         15 . The supply element of  claim 1 , wherein said seal of said at least one third supplier is adapted to be pierced by an end of said first supplier to enable said substance to be transferred from said at least one third supplier to the first supplier of the microchip.
